Top 5 Hospital Games on Unified Platform in Austria, Q4 2023
The top hospital games in Austria showed varied performance in Q4 2023, with notable trends in downloads, revenue, and active users.
In Q4 2023, the top 5 hospital games in Austria displayed diverse trends in downloads, revenue, and weekly active users. This data, sourced from Sensor Tower, provides key insights into the app performance on both iOS and Android platforms.
Happy Hospital™: ASMR Game by DragonPlus Game Limited saw a gradual decline in revenue, starting from $5.5K in late September and dropping to around $3.5K by the end of December. Downloads peaked at 1.7K in late October but decreased significantly to 446 by the end of the quarter. Weekly active users increased steadily, peaking at 8.7K in late October before stabilizing around 7.5K in December.
Match Frenzy™ - Take Test from JoyPlay Pte.Ltd. experienced a revenue increase early in the quarter, reaching $1.4K in late October, before declining to $535 by the end of December. Downloads spiked at 1.8K in late October but dropped to 97 by the end of December. Weekly active users saw a peak of 2.2K in late October but declined to 398 by the end of the quarter.
Beauty Care! by Ruby Games AS showed fluctuating revenue, peaking at $29 in late September and dropping to $9 by the end of December. Downloads had a significant spike to 1.5K in late October and another peak of 1.1K in late December. Weekly active users saw a peak at 2.6K in late October and another rise to 1.6K by the end of December.
Crazy Hospital®️ from Smart Fun Casual Games showed a steady increase in revenue, beginning at $849 in late September and rising to $1.7K by the end of December. Downloads peaked at 966 in late October but ended the quarter at 346. Weekly active users saw consistent growth, peaking at 3.6K in mid-December before dropping slightly to 3.3K by the end of the month.
Central Hospital Stories by SUBARA had low revenue throughout the quarter, peaking at $17 in mid-November. Downloads showed a steady increase, peaking at 461 by the end of December. Weekly active users grew steadily, reaching 676 by the end of the quarter.
